Understanding Strategy Games

Strategy games are a genre that focus on tactical and strategic challenges, requiring players to make decisions that can significantly affect the outcome of the game. Unlike simple action games, these titles demand critical thinking, foresight, and planning.

Comparative Analysis of Strategy Games and Other Genres

To truly understand their impact, let's compare strategy games with other genres such as action and role-playing games (RPGs). While action games often focus on reflexes and speed, strategy games require deep thought and planning. Table 1 below illustrates these differences:

Aspect Strategy Games Action Games
Thinking Type Critical and Tactical Reflexive and Shallow
Game Pace Calculated Fast-Paced
Decision Making Long-term Planning Immediate Reaction

Benefits of Playing Strategy Games

What are the cognitive benefits of playing strategy games? Here are some critical advantages:

  1. Improved Problem-Solving Skills: Strategies must be formulated to overcome obstacles.
  2. Enhanced Decision-Making: Critical choices lead to various outcomes.
  3. Resource Management: Players learn how to allocate resources effectively.
  4. Increased Creativity: Unconventional solutions can lead to success.
  5. Social Interaction: Many strategy games are multiplayer, promoting teamwork.

Learning Valuable Life Skills through Strategy Games

Interestingly, the skills learned from strategy games often translate into real-life scenarios. Players develop leadership qualities, negotiate effectively in multiplayer settings, and learn to cope with failure while revising their strategies. The importance of these skills cannot be overstated.
